Types of Coffee Beans and Their Characteristics

Arabica: The most popular coffee in the world, known for its delicious, diverse flavors and light acidity. Arabica is typically grown in high-altitude regions with a cool climate.

Robusta: Contains a higher caffeine content than Arabica, with a strong, bitter taste and robust aroma. Robusta is often used in traditional Vietnamese drip coffee or as an ingredient in instant coffee.

Liberica: A coffee with a unique flavor, less widely cultivated but with a dedicated following. The taste of Liberica is often described as rich, slightly spicy, and smoky.

Coffee Brewing Methods: From Traditional to Modern

From the traditional Vietnamese phin coffee to the robust espresso, or the elegant filter coffee, each brewing method offers a unique experience. Every coffee lover can find a method that suits their preferences.

Phin Coffee: The traditional Vietnamese method, creating a rich, flavorful cup of coffee.

Espresso: A quick extraction method, producing a strong, concentrated cup of coffee.

Filter coffee (pour over): A slow extraction method, creating an elegant, refined cup of coffee.

French press: A simple brewing method, creating a rich, full-bodied cup of coffee.
